How does Kuhn’s concept of "paradigm incommensurability" challenge traditional views of scientific comparison?


Kuhn's concept of "paradigm incommensurability" challenges traditional views of scientific comparison by suggesting that different scientific paradigms are fundamentally incompatible and cannot be objectively compared using a common set of criteria. This challenges the traditional view that scientific progress is achieved through cumulative consensus and that different paradigms can be objectively compared based on their empirical evidence and explanatory power.

Instead, Kuhn argues that different scientific paradigms are characterized by different underlying assumptions, methodologies, and criteria for evaluating evidence, making it difficult or impossible to reach a common understanding or agreement about which paradigm is "better" or more accurate. This challenges the traditional view that scientific progress is achieved through a linear process of accumulating knowledge and building upon previous theories.

By highlighting the idea of paradigm incommensurability, Kuhn suggests that scientific progress is more complex and non-linear than traditionally believed, and that it may involve radical shifts in thinking and changes in fundamental assumptions rather than simply building upon existing knowledge. This challenges the notion of a single, objective standard for comparing scientific theories and suggests that scientific comparison may be more subjective and context-dependent than previously thought.

How does Kuhn’s notion of scientific progress differ from the linear accumulation model proposed by earlier philosophers?


Kuhn's notion of scientific progress differs from the linear accumulation model proposed by earlier philosophers in several key ways. The linear accumulation model suggests that scientific knowledge progresses steadily over time, with new discoveries building upon and adding to existing knowledge in a linear fashion. This model assumes that scientific knowledge is cumulative and that each new discovery enhances and refines our understanding of the world.

In contrast, Kuhn's notion of scientific progress emphasizes the idea of scientific revolutions, in which existing paradigms are challenged and overturned by new and revolutionary ideas. Kuhn argues that scientific progress is not always linear or cumulative, but rather occurs in fits and starts as old paradigms are replaced by new ones. These revolutions are often characterized by drastic shifts in scientific thinking, with new paradigms radically changing our understanding of the world.

Additionally, Kuhn's notion of scientific progress also highlights the role of social and cultural factors in shaping scientific advancements. He argues that scientific progress is not just driven by objective evidence and logic, but also by the beliefs, values, and biases of the scientific community. This means that scientific progress is not always rational or objective, but can be influenced by personal and societal factors.

Overall, Kuhn's notion of scientific progress challenges the idea of steady, cumulative advancement put forth by earlier philosophers, and instead suggests that scientific knowledge is complex, evolving, and deeply influenced by social and cultural factors.

What are the implications of Kuhn’s theory for fields outside of natural sciences, such as the social sciences or humanities?


Kuhn's theory of scientific revolutions has profound implications for fields outside of natural sciences, such as the social sciences or humanities. In these non-scientific fields, paradigms also play a crucial role in shaping the ways in which knowledge is constructed and accepted within a particular discipline.

One implication of Kuhn's theory is that it challenges the notion of objective and universal truth in the social sciences and humanities. Kuhn argues that paradigms dictate what is considered valid knowledge within a particular field, and these paradigms are often influenced by cultural, historical, and social factors. This means that what is considered true or valid in one paradigm may not be accepted in another paradigm, undermining the idea of objective truth.

Additionally, Kuhn's theory suggests that new knowledge in the social sciences and humanities often emerges through periods of crisis and revolution, where existing paradigms are challenged and new paradigms are developed. This challenges the idea of linear progress in these fields and highlights the importance of periods of instability and uncertainty in driving intellectual advancement.

Finally, Kuhn's theory also emphasizes the role of communities of scholars in shaping and maintaining paradigms in non-scientific fields. These communities play a crucial role in determining what research is considered legitimate and worthy of recognition, and can therefore influence the direction of knowledge production in a particular discipline.

Overall, Kuhn's theory of scientific revolutions has important implications for fields outside of natural sciences, challenging traditional notions of truth and progress and highlighting the role of paradigms and communities of scholars in shaping knowledge in the social sciences and humanities.
